MySQL是一種開源的關系型數據庫管理系統,它可以通過SQL語言來進行數據的管理和檢索。在日常的數據處理中,我們經常需要查詢某個部門中工資最高的員工,以便更好地進行業務分析和管理決策。
假設我們有一個名為employee的表,其中包含員工的姓名、部門、工資等信息?,F在我們需要查詢每個部門中工資最高的員工記錄。
SELECT * FROM employee e1 WHERE salary = ( SELECT MAX(salary) FROM employee e2 WHERE e1.department = e2.department );
上述代碼中,我們首先在外部查詢中使用e1來表示employee表,然后通過一個子查詢,在內部查找每個部門的最高工資。這里使用e2來表示employee表的別名,并根據部門將結果進行分組,然后輸出結果。
通過這樣的方式,我們可以很容易地查詢出每個部門中工資最高的員工信息,有助于我們更好地了解和管理企業的人員情況和業務運營情況。